<description>&#60;p&#62;You really should feel a firmness/hardening g of the area with Braxton Hicks that lasts less than a minute or so and goes away. Usually not at all painful, just weird. How low is the pain? Round ligament pain can be cramps, is often on one side but can be both, and doesn't come with any tightening.
